How exactly do you round file the NIC? The NIC lives in the transition agreement between US east AND America West. The NIC will become active for the US Airways pilots once we are all on a Single contract.

We will all be on a single contract prior to any M/B arbitration. Hence the activation of the NIC. The NIC will then be the list the company sets forth to the arbitrator along with Americans seniority list.

The East still has the right to vote NO on any contract that will include the NIC. That is their option and I wouldn't be suprised if they do turn down a 60k dollar pay raise. However, once the NMB declares APA the barganing agent for all pilots. The East will be the minority an APA will vote a contract in for us all.

Now of course the transition agreement can be modified by the company and USAPA to include language other than the NIC for seniority. In my mind that would be great because of the damages that will be awarded to the west.

So basically there is no way around the NIC, unless of course USAPA can come up with a Legitimate Union Purpose for altering an agreed upon seniority list and an agreed upon transition agreement.

With or without the east the NIC will be the list. Get a contract now or wait 2 years. It's up to you. Is this clear yet? I'd be happy to explain over a beer.
